EDA 550 School Finance

A study of the historical development and current system of public school finance in New York; theoretical issues and policy choices facing educators everywhere will be related to actual questions of school finance; a central theme will be the possibility of equity for both students and taxpayers in a period of declining resources. This is a core requirement for the M.S. degree and the School Building Leader certification program. Spring or Summer. (3 credits)
